The State of The Gundo
Gundo had this huge hooplah moment in early 2024. The Party Bus™️ was the peak.
Many said it was all noise. Candidly, at that point, it was a lot of noise. A dozen pre-seed companies actually don’t have much hardware or traction to show off, which should be no surprise, but for which we caught flack. So we decided to go quiet until we, collectively, could put our money where our mouth is and build civilization changing technology.
And if you can believe it, Gundo has been deliberately quiet this past year. Yes, there has been a slow drip of partnerships announcements, unveilings of hardware, huge contracts won.
Gundo companies:
- built a viable thermal prototype reactor faster than any fission company in the game.
- are doing high rate production of the most lethal drones in Europe and Asian theaters.
- modifying the weather on 3 continents and producing desalination-scale volumes of water.
- monitoring national parks and military installations across the planet with the most rugged and adaptable ISR platform in the US.
- manufacturing turbomachinery faster and cheaper for all the fanciest aerospace companies you know.
- coring critical mineral deposits throughout the American west.
And the list goes on.
And we’re all making big revenue.
And we’ve only talked about ~20% of what the Gundo companies have accomplished.
And dozens of brand new, electrifying my ambitious companies have joined this year. More coming still.
And in the next 9 months, previously unthinkable things will roll out from these founders and teams.
And when that happens, we’ll be loud and proud of having done great things.
This little town is going to be one of the most important parts of the American story of the 21st century. To those that believed in us in the beginning, thank you. To those that have joined since, welcome. To those remaining to be convinced, we look forward to building things worthy of your support.

HUGE NEWS for El Segundo: Interlagos, a technology invesmtnent fund, born and based in City of El Segundo is targeting $550M for their 1st fund! Fund Founders Tom Ochinero & Achal Upadhyaya have worked here in El Segundo for more than 3 decades, including at the original SpaceX HQ on Grand Ave here in El Segundo. We are beyond stoked that they will be continuing to build companies here in El Segundo. Achal previously invested in and brought two companies (Neros Technologies & Shinkei) here from the east coast to El Segundo and we look forward to so much more growth! https://t.co/7f6NuzNMna @achalsu@cityofelsegundo@SpaceX
